Commercial ceiling painting services involve the professional application of paint or coatings to the ceilings of various types of commercial properties. This process typically includes surface preparation, such as cleaning and patching, to ensure a smooth and durable finish. Service providers use specialized tools and techniques to achieve an even coat that enhances the appearance of the space while protecting the ceiling surface from damage over time. Whether updating the look of an office, retail store, or industrial facility, these professionals focus on delivering a clean, professional finish that aligns with the property's aesthetic and functional needs.
One common reason property owners seek commercial ceiling painting is to address issues related to aging or damaged ceilings. Over time, ceilings can accumulate stains, cracks, or peeling paint, which can detract from the overall appearance of a space. Additionally, ceilings in commercial settings may suffer from water damage, mold, or discoloration due to humidity or leaks. Professional ceiling painting helps solve these problems by restoring the surface, covering imperfections, and preventing further deterioration. The overview below groups typical Commercial Ceiling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Commercial Projects - Typical costs for small-scale ceiling painting jobs in commercial spaces gener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ine maintenance or touch-up projects fall within this band, depending on size and complexity.
Medium-Sized Commercial Spaces - Larger commercial ceilings, such as offices or retail stores, often c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this range are common, with fewer exceeding the upper end due to additional prep or special finishes.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ive commercial ceiling painting, including multiple rooms or high ceilings, can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. These projects are less frequent and typically involve more preparation, surface repairs, or specialty coatings.
Full Replacement or Specialty Coatings - Complete ceiling replacements or specialty finishes like textured or fire-resistant coatings can cost $8,000+ depending on size and complexity. Such projects are usually at the higher end of the spectrum due to material and labor demands.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ing commercial ceiling painting service providers,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. A contractor with a proven track record in commercial environments will be familiar with the unique challenges and requirements that such spaces demand. Asking about past work can help determine if a service provider has successfully handled ceilings of comparable size, height, and surface conditions. This insight ensures that the contractor understands the scope and complexity of the job, which can contribute to a smoother and more efficient process.
Clear written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ors for ceiling painting projects. A reputable service provider should be able to articulate what the job will entail, including surface preparation, types of paint used, and the scope of work. Having these details in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that both parties are aligned on the project’s objectives. It’s also beneficial to inquire about warranties or guarantees, as these can provide additional confidence in the quality of the work.
Reputable references and effective communication are key indicators of a reliable commercial ceiling painter. Contacting previous clients can provide insights into the contractor’s professionalism, punctuality, and overall quality of work. Additionally, good communication throughout the process-such as responsiveness to questions and clarity in explanations-can make the experience more straightforward and less stressful. What is commercial ceiling painting? Commercial ceiling painting involves applying paint or coatings to ceilings in business or industrial spaces to improve appearance and protect surfaces.
What types of ceilings can local contractors paint? They can handle various ceiling types including drywall, acoustic tiles, suspended ceilings, and concrete surfaces.
How do local service providers prepare for ceiling painting projects? They typically assess the ceiling condition, clean surfaces, and cover nearby areas to ensure a clean and professional finish.
Are there different finishes available for commercial ceiling painting? Yes, options include matte, flat, or semi-gloss finishes, depending on the desired look and function of the space.
